What are Seamless Gutters?

Definition and Description

Seamless gutters are a type of rainwater management system characterized by their lack of seams or joints along their lengths. Unlike traditional gutters, which are assembled from multiple sections joined together, seamless gutters are custom-made in one continuous piece.

This design significantly reduces the potential for leaks, as the absence of seams reduces break points where water can escape. Typically crafted from durable materials such as aluminum, seamless gutters offer enhanced longevity. Their sleek construction not only improves function but also adds to the aesthetic appeal of the home.

Installation Process

The installation of seamless gutters is a straightforward yet precise process performed by professional gutter companies. It begins with an on-site visit where the professionals accurately measure the dimensions of your home. The gutters are then fabricated on-site to ensure a perfect fit, utilizing specialized machinery that forms the gutters from a single roll of material. Expert installers then secure the gutters, ensuring proper alignment and slope for optimal water flow. This precision-driven process guarantees seamless integration into your home’s existing exterior design.

Materials Used

Several materials are commonly used in the manufacturing of seamless gutters, each offering distinct benefits. Aluminum is the most prevalent due to its lightweight nature and resistance to rust, making it ideal for various climates. Copper gutters, although more expensive, offer unparalleled durability and an aesthetic appeal that can enhance a home’s historic or high-end look. Additionally, steel offers superior strength but might require more maintenance to prevent rust. Each material brings its own set of advantages, and selecting the right one can significantly impact the longevity and effectiveness of the gutter system.

Benefits of Seamless Design

The seamless design of these gutters provides several key benefits over their sectional counterparts. First, the absence of seams reduces the chance of leaks, which is a common problem in traditional gutter systems where joints can weaken over time. This results in less maintenance and a reduced risk of water pooling around the foundation. Additionally, seamless gutters experience fewer clogs and backups since debris has fewer places to accumulate. Finally, the uniform look of seamless gutters enhances the overall curb appeal of the home, offering both functional and aesthetic advantages.

Comparison with Traditional Gutters

When compared to traditional gutters, seamless gutters offer substantial improvements in performance and durability. Traditional gutter systems, made of multiple sections, are prone to leaking at the seams where pieces join together. Over time, these joints can deteriorate, leading to costly repairs or replacements. In contrast, seamless gutters eliminate this issue entirely, providing a more reliable solution. Additionally, seamless gutters tend to last longer and require less maintenance since there are fewer weak points that can fail. Homeowners may find that investing in seamless gutters offers superior value over time due to these performance enhancements.
